I don't know much about postgres, but as I understand it, it's a pretty standard server application. Read a request from the client, work on the request, send the result, read the next request. Changing that to poll for a cancellation while working is a big change. Also, the server would need to buffer any pipelined requests while looking for a cancellation request. A second connection is not without wrinkles, but it avoids a lot of network complexity. | ||
